LOW LGM TEST RESULT REFERENT VALUES FOR ADULTS. What does low lgM test result referent values for adults level mean?

Lower limit of normal lgM test result referent values for adults is 54(mg/dl).

IgM antibodies are the largest antibody. IgM antibodies are about 5% to 10% of all the antibodies in the body.

IgM deficiency may occur as a primary or secondary condition. Secondary IgM deficiency is much more common than primary IgM deficiency and may be seen in association with malignancy, autoimmune disease, gastrointestinal disease, and immunosuppressive treatment.
